Russia: our oil exports remain stable despite sanctions

Russia: our oil exports remain stable despite sanctions

Russian Deputy Prime Minister Novak made assessments of the oil markets in a statement to Russian state channel Rossiya-24.

Noting the ongoing uncertainties in the global oil markets, Novak said: “We see a lot of uncertainties being discussed constantly. These are specific questions about the global economy, an increase in supply or growth in demand.” he said.

Explaining that the Chinese economy has started to open up and they are expecting an increase in oil consumption, Novak said: “Furthermore, inflation expectations have not gone away and we are closely watching the steps that the central banks of the major economies of the world will take. world. “said he.

“PRICES ARE ACCEPTABLE”

Noting that they held talks with the Organization of the Petroleum Exporting Countries (OPEC) and OPEC+, which consists of non-OPEC oil-producing countries, Novak said: “The talks showed that everyone agreed that the situation in the oil market is stable. Prices are at an acceptable level in line with supply and demand.” he made the comment of him.

Regarding the Russian oil sector, where extensive sanctions apply, Novak said: “Despite the European embargo and the maximum price, the situation regarding our oil production and exports is stable. Our companies have taken all the necessary measures, especially to find new supply chains and markets.” he performed the assessment of it.
